CO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
A refreshing light summer offering made with wheat malt and a touch of organic buckwheat honey.

Draft sample at Barleys #1. Poured clear golden color with an average fizzy white head that mostly lasted with fair lacing. Moderate apple honey and wheat aroma. Medium body with a smooth texture and soft carbonation. Medium sweet flavor with a medium sweet finish of moderate duration. Soft summer brew.
